#!/usr/bin/env python2
import os, mimetypes, json, cgi, recode, time, urllib, events, threading
from config import config
from directory import Directory, File
class Application(object):
# Application handlers
def files(self, environ, start_response, path):
full_path = os.path.join(config.get('music_root'), *path[1:])
rel_path = os.path.join(*path[1:] or '.')
if os.path.isdir(full_path):
start_response('200 OK', [('Content-Type', 'text/html; charset=UTF-8')])
return (str(x) for x in Directory(rel_path).listdir())
else:
args = cgi.FieldStorage(environ = environ)
decoder = args.getvalue('decoder') if 'decoder' in args else None
encoder = args.getvalue('encoder') if 'encoder' in args else None
if decoder and encoder:
cache_file = File(rel_path).get_cache_file()
return File(cache_file, True).send(environ, start_response)
else:
return File(rel_path).send(environ, start_response)
def static(self, environ, start_response, path):
filename = os.path.join('static', *path[1:])
if not os.access(filename, os.F_OK) or '..' in path:
start_response('404 Not Found', [])
return []
mime = mimetypes.guess_type(filename, strict = False)[0] or 'application/octet-stream'
start_response('200 OK', [('Content-Type', mime)])
return open(filename, 'rb')
# JSON handlers
def json_list(self, environ, start_response, path):
args = cgi.FieldStorage(environ = environ)
directory = args.getvalue('directory') if 'directory' in args else '/'
d = Directory(directory)
contents = d.listdir()
start_response('200 OK', [('Content-Type', 'text/plain')])
s = json.dumps([x.json() for x in contents])
return s
def json_cache(self, environ, start_response, path):
args = cgi.FieldStorage(environ = environ)
path = args.getvalue('path') if 'path' in args else None
decoder = args.getvalue('decoder') if 'decoder' in args else None
encoder = args.getvalue('encoder') if 'encoder' in args else None
f = File(path)
t = threading.Thread(target = f.recode, args = (decoder, encoder))
t.start()
start_response('200 OK', [('Content-Type', 'text/plain')])
return []
def json_is_cached(self, environ, start_response, path):
args = cgi.FieldStorage(environ = environ)
path = args.getvalue('path') if 'path' in args else None
cache_file = os.path.join(config.get('cache_dir'), path)
cache_file = os.path.splitext(cache_file)[0] + '.mp3'
start_response('200 OK', [('Content-Type', 'text/plain')])
return json.dumps(os.path.exists(cache_file))
handlers = {
'files': files,
'static': static,
'list': json_list,
'cache': json_cache,
'is_cached': json_is_cached,
'events': events.EventSubscriber,
}
# WSGI handler
def __call__(self, environ, start_response):
path = urllib.unquote(environ['PATH_INFO'])
path = path.split('/')[1:]
module = path[0] or None
if not module:
module = 'static'
path = ['static', 'index.html']
if module in self.handlers:
return self.handlers[module](self, environ, start_response, path)
start_response('404 Not Found', [('Content-Type', 'text/plain')])
return [str(path)]
if __name__ == '__main__':
import sys
if len(sys.argv) == 3:
from flup.server.fcgi import WSGIServer
WSGIServer(Application(), bindAddress = (sys.argv[1], int(sys.argv[2]))).run()
else:
from wsgiref.simple_server import make_server, WSGIServer
# enable IPv6
WSGIServer.address_family |= 10
httpd = make_server('', 8000, Application())
httpd.serve_forever()
